How to manually update OneDrive
- Go to OneDrive’s Settings to find the current version number.
- Click the version number to open the OneDrive webpage.
- Click “Download OneDrive for Windows” to install the latest version.

How often is OneDrive updated?
The OneDrive sync app checks for available updates every 24 hours when it’s running. If it has stopped and hasn’t checked for updates in more than 24 hours, the sync app will check for updates as soon as it’s started. Windows 10 also has a scheduled task that updates the sync app even when it’s not running.
How do I set up OneDrive on my PC?
How to set up OneDrive on Windows 10
- Open Start.
- Search OneDrive and click the top result to open the app.
- Confirm the Microsoft account address.
- Click the Sign in button.
- Confirm your account password.
- Click the Sign in button again.

How do I add an existing folder to OneDrive?
On the left navigation pane, under OneDrive, select Shared. Files and folders that you can add to your OneDrive are marked Can edit. Locate the folder you want to add, select the circle in the folder’s tile, and then select Add to my OneDrive on the top menu. Or right-click a folder and select Add to my OneDrive.
